Output ebe2499c9988f6b61f2347161689a14f1e4364aeac1dc693feaa270afa645c28:14

value
2544019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d60e957f5d92e859c613cfee6f0dce63df9efa4 OP_EQUAL
address
3G3A7Byhp7gY5R11AVxywLCoBMmVf56Biz
transaction
ebe2499c9988f6b61f2347161689a14f1e4364aeac1dc693feaa270afa645c28
spent
true